402.01 Description.
This Section shall cover the work of constructing a surface course approxim ately 1/8 to 3/8 of an inch {3 to 10 mm} in thickness placed on existing paved surfaces in accordance with these specifications and within reasonably close conformity to the lines, grades, and widths shown on the drawings and as specified.
402.02 Materials .
a.Asphalt Emulsion . CQS-1h or CQS -1hp shall meet the requirements of Section 804.
b.Aggregate . Aggregate shall meet the appropriate requirements of Section 801 and 802 with lightweight aggregate and manufactured sand made from limestone added to the list of approved stones.
c.Filler . Filler, if required, shall meet the requirements of Section 805.
d.Water . The water shall be potable and free from harmful soluble salt.
e.Composition of Mixtures . The aggregate, asphalt emulsion, water and, if required, filler meeting the requirements herein specified, shall conform to the composition by weight {mass} percentages as specified by the Engineer, but within the limits of Table A of this Section. Type I. This aggregate blend is used to seal cracks an d fill voids. It should be used on areas where a minimum wearing surface and a maximum seal is desired. This fine gradation requires an application rate of 4 to 10 pounds {2 to 5 kg} of dry aggregate per square yard {square meter}. Type II. This aggregate blend is used to give crown corrections and a moderate wearing surface. This surface course shall be used in areas that require this size of aggregate to fill in voids and leave a substantial wearing surface. This gradation requires an application rate of 10 to 20 pounds {5 to 10 kg} of dry aggregate per square yard {square meter} resulting in a surface thickness of approximately 1/8 to 3/8 of an inch {3 to 10 mm}. The slurry seal shall meet the requirements of Subarticle 410.02(b) where applicable.

402.03 Construction Requirements.
a.Weather Limitations . The weather limitations as specified in Item 410.03(b)1 shall apply except that slurry seal shall not be placed when the air temperature is 50 °F {10 °C} or lower; nor when the temperature of the pavement on which it is to be placed is 50 °F {10 °C} or lower.
b.Equipment Requirements . The slurry seal mixing equipment shall be an approved self -propelled, continuous -flow apparatus consisting of a composite of all the required units herein described. The apparatus shall be capable of proportioning, combining, and mi xing accurately the specified components into a homogeneous mixture with an asphalt film of sufficient thickness to furnish the desired binding properties. This apparatus shall contain bins, tanks, and receptacles of sufficient size and volume, proportioni ng feeders, liquid measuring meters or devices, mechanical mixer, and distributor for placing the finished mixture. All units shall be integrated, mechanized, and synchronized to deliver the component to the mixer simultaneously and in time adjusted sequen ce.
c.Mixer . The mixer shall be of the spiraled, multi -blade type or other type as approved by the Engineer. The mixing chamber shall have a stated capacity which shall not be exceeded and it shall be mechanically equipped to regulate the mixing time up to but not to exceed four minutes. It shall be equipped to pre -wet the aggregate prior to aggregate contact with the asphalt emulsion. It shall have a gate for controlling the discharge of the mixture into the distributor spreader.
d.Spreading Equipment . A mechanically operated type squeegee distributor shall be integrally assembled with the slurry mixer. The strike- off shall be lined with a flexible material to prevent loss of the slurry mixture during spreading. The strike- off shall have vertical adjust ment available for changing grade and crown to assure uniform spreading of the mixture. The apparatus shall be equipped with a pressure system and a fog type spray bar adequate for placing a complete fog coat of water with a maximum application of 0.05 gal lons per square yard {0.25 L/m²} over the pavement surface immediately preceding the spreading of the mixture. Hand squeegees, shovels, surface cleaning machines, and hand equipment as necessary, shall be provided to perform the work.
e.Conditioning Of E xisting Surface . Conditioning of the existing surface shall be in accordance with Subarticle 410.03(c).
f.Placement . The temperature of the components of the completed mixture shall be so controlled that the application temperature of the slurry seal sha ll be within the range designated by the Engineer but not less than 50 °F {10 °C} nor more than 125 °F {50 °C} .
1.Transverse Joints . Transverse joints shall be constructed by either overlapping the previously cured slurry with 10 to 15 feet { 3 to 4 m} of fresh slurry or by lightly wetting the area that the spreader box will touch while the slurry is still in a completely uncured, semi -fluid condition.

2.Longitudinal Joints . Longitudinal joints shall be constructed when the slurry is completel y uncured or when it is totally cured. Should the slurry be completely cured, the cured slurry at the joint area shall be wetted by the spray bar. Should the slurry be completely uncured, the slurry shall not be wetted. A burlap drag, or other suitable dev ice, that will cause the fresh slurry coming from the spreader box to distribute itself evenly over the joint, shall be pulled along the joint seam.
h.Curing . Treated areas shall be allowed to cure until such time as the Engineer or inspector -in-charge s hall permit their opening to traffic. All traffic shall be diverted up to a maximum of 24 hours to permit undisturbed curing of the slurry or until such time as curing has taken place and rolling has been completed.
i.Rolling . Any rolling required for th e slurry seal shall be done with a pneumatic roller. The roller shall be capable of exerting a contact pressure during rolling of 350 to 450 kPa. Rolling shall consist of not less than four complete coverages over the specified areas.
j.Tack Coat . When s pecified, a tack coat shall be placed in accordance with Section 405.
402.04 Method of Measurement.
The amount of slurry seal coat, applied as directed and accepted, will be measured in square yards {square meters}. The length will be the actual length mea sured along the surface. The width will be the actual width sealed as shown on the plans or directed.
402.05 Basis of Payment.
a.Unit Price Coverage . The number of square yards {square meters}, measured as provided above, will be paid for at the contract unit price for the item of Slurry Seal Coat of the type specified on the plans, complete in place, which price shall be payment in full for furnishing all materials and constructing the Slurry Seal Coat, and for all equipment, tools, labor, and in cidentals necessary to complete the work.

403.01 Description.
This Section covers the materials, equipment, construction, and application procedures for placing Micro -Surfacing material for filling ruts and for surfacing existing paved surfaces. The Micro -Surfacing shall be a mixture of a poly mer modified asphalt emulsion, 100 percent crushed mineral aggregate, mineral filler, water, and other additives for control of set time in the field. All ingredients shall be properly proportioned, mixed, and spread on the paved surface in accordance with the Specification and as directed by the Engineer.
